Easy and Simple Troubleshooting Tips





What is the very first thing that you should do when you trouble shoot your computer? The first thing that anyone should do when troubleshooting a computer that is still working with an OS is to restart the computer. Once you restart the computer the computer will reload all the programs in its cache and will in some cases fix any conflicts of software.

The next thing to do is to check all connections as your computer restarts. Check not only the power but also things like mice and other hardware that may be connected to your system. It is also a good idea to disconnect all external devices from your computer while you do some of these troubleshooting steps. Disconnect all USB drives and external sources of storage. Check the computer for unusual sounds. Also check to see if there are heating issues with the computer. There are normal noises that a computer makes, check to see if there are any hissing noises. If there are any abnormal noises then immediately turn off your computer. Also make sure that you switch of your computer if you experience heating issues.

Start the computer normally and start a virus scan. Most of the time viruses affect software and hardware. If you are unable to load the computer in normal mode, run it in safe mode. If the problem began after installing a program then you can uninstall the program and run your computer. for many software issues system restore is a good option that is provided on most window platforms. If you are experiencing intermittent issues even after fixing some minor issues then you should also consider reworking the strategy by reversing your steps to when and how the program started. In most cases it will lead you to the root of the problem. Remember that a problem once identified is half solved.
